Three injured after driver loses control on car in B’klyn

Three young women were injured last night when a driver lost control of his car and jumped a curb in Brooklyn, authorities said.

The driver was traveling north on Ocean Ave. near Voorhies Ave. in Sheepshead Bay at around 5:30 p.m. when he lost control of his Nissan Sentra, critically injuring a woman in her early 20s. Two teenage girls also suffered minor injuries.

All three victims were taken to Lutheran Medical Center.

Thirteen-year-old victim Suzanna Gorodetskiy said her and a friend were returning from a nearby Rite Aid when they realized the car was headed their way.

“We saw the car and we started screaming,” said victim Suzanna Gorodetskiy, 13. “It just came and hit us.”

Gorodetskiy said her 14-year-old friend suffered a broken leg but was expected to be ok.

Authorities did not immediately have information on the critically injured woman’s condition.

Cops said they do not suspect any criminality at this time.
